DJ Service Recruits Professional DJs Across South Africa

DJ Service expands team of professional DJs for weddings and corporate events across South Africa as event industry reaches USD 6.6 billion valuation.

Meyerton, Gauteng, South Africa, 22nd Oct 2025 – DJ Service, a professional entertainment company with over 15 years of experience, has announced recruitment efforts for skilled DJs across South Africa to meet growing demand for wedding and corporate event services. The company specializes in providing trained DJs for weddings, corporate events, private parties, club events, and MC services throughout the country.

The recruitment initiative responds to expansion in South Africa’s events industry, which was valued at USD 6.6 billion in 2023 according to government reports. South Africa’s DJ equipment market reached USD 5.11 million in 2024 and is projected to grow to USD 9.76 million by 2033, reflecting increased investment in professional audio technology across the entertainment sector. The South African MICE sector, which encompasses meetings, incentives, conferences, and exhibitions, is projected to reach USD 25.9 billion by 2032 from its 2023 valuation of USD 6.6 billion. This growth creates opportunities for professional entertainment providers serving corporate and business event segments.
